今天碰到一个挺恶心的问题,findviewbyid一直返回null,在这记录一下以访下次再碰到。
这问题确实挺恶心的,啥都没毛病就是不知道为啥返回null,在setContentView后面找的id就是返回null,后来把其他的findviewbyid全部注掉留下个findViewById(R.id.photo_view_back).setOnClickListener(new View.OnClickListener(),报了个java.lang.NoSuchFieldError: No field photo_view_back of type I in class Lcom/tencent/qcloud/tim/uikit/R$id; or its superclasses (declaration of 'com.tencent.qcloud.tim.uikit.R$id' appears in /data/app/com.bojiu.timestory-1/base.apk:classes2.dex)这个错误,在网上一搜,说是可能就是布局文件名字重复了(因为我这个一个是在三方的module里面一个是项目里面),找到那个重名的布局文件重命名一下就ok了,淦